- The distance between Subiaco, Ar, Usa and Cisa Pass, Italy is approximately 8,325 km or 5,173 mi.
- To reach Subiaco, Ar in this distance one would set out from Cisa Pass bearing 304.5°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Subiaco, Ar bearing 225.8° or SW .
- Subiaco, Ar has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Cisa Pass has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Both are in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ome.
- The average temperature is 8.5 °C (15.3°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 6 °C (10.8°F) more in Subiaco, Ar.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to semicont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 2015.7 mm (79.4 in) less which is equivalent to 2015.7 l/m² (49.47 US gal/ft²) or 20,157,000 l/ha (2,154,917 US gal/ac) less. About 1/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 9.5° higher in Subiaco, Ar than in Cisa Pass.
